[关于瘤胃发酵及育肥牛营养物质消化率的各种糖-尿素和糖-淀粉-尿素关系的研究]

[Studies on the various sugar-urea and sugar-starch-urea relationships with reference to the fermentation in the rumen and the digestibility of nutrients in fattening cattle].

作者信息

Sommer A, Pajtás M, Herceg J, Skultétyová N

出版信息

Arch Tierernahr. 1975 Jul;25(5):365-77. doi: 10.1080/17450397509423200.

DOI:10.1080/17450397509423200
PMID:1241938
Abstract

Recommendations are given saying that sugar-to-crude fibre rations of not more than 1.7:1 and sugar-to-urea ratios of 12:1 should be used in the fattening of cattle fed urea-supplemented rations of roughages in which 40% to 50% of the crude protein content of the ration had been replaced by urea. The amount of sugar per kg live-weight should not exceed 4 g. Higher quantities reduce the digestibility of crude fibre and, additionally, decrease the NH3 level and the pH in the rumen. At the same time the amount of volatile fatty acids is increased while the content of ruminal acetic acid decreases. Variations in the sugar-to-starch ratio had no statistically significant influence on the nitrogen balance whereas it was found that increasing quantities of sugar significantly decreased the digestibility of crude fibre. The proportional content of sugar in the readily metabolisable carbohydrates contained in the ration should not exceed 20% to 50%.

摘要

建议指出,在用尿素补充粗饲料日粮育肥牛时,糖与粗纤维的比例不应超过1.7:1,糖与尿素的比例应为12:1,其中日粮粗蛋白含量的40%至50%已被尿素替代。每千克活体重的糖含量不应超过4克。更高的量会降低粗纤维的消化率,此外,还会降低瘤胃中的氨水平和pH值。同时,挥发性脂肪酸的量会增加,而瘤胃乙酸的含量会降低。糖与淀粉比例的变化对氮平衡没有统计学上的显著影响,而发现糖量增加会显著降低粗纤维的消化率。日粮中易代谢碳水化合物所含糖的比例不应超过20%至50%。
